7 Young Indian Pacers Earn BCCI Contracts

Stellar IPL Performances Recognized

Young Indian pacers Mayank Yadav, Akash Deep, Vijaykumar Vyshak, Tushar Deshpande, Umran Malik, and Yash Dayal have earned central contracts from the BCCI following their impressive performances in IPL 2024. These emerging stars are expected to become India’s frontline pacers in the shortest format of the game, setting a strong foundation for the country’s bowling attack in T20 cricket.

Mayank Yadav’s Remarkable Impact

Mayank Yadav, representing the Lucknow Super Giants (LSG), made a significant impact with his raw pace in limited opportunities. In just four matches, he claimed seven wickets at an outstanding average of 12.14 and an economy rate of 6.98. His ability to deliver crucial breakthroughs and maintain a low economy rate has been pivotal for his team. Despite his success in the IPL, Mayank has not been included in India’s tour to Zimbabwe, which features several other IPL performers. This exclusion has raised eyebrows, considering his promising talent and potential.

Tushar Deshpande’s Consistent Performance

Tushar Deshpande showcased his skills once again this season, delivering a strong performance even though his team, CSK, was knocked out before the playoffs. Deshpande’s ability to bowl with precision and adapt to different match situations has made him a reliable asset. His consistent performances over multiple IPL seasons have cemented his reputation as a dependable fast bowler.

Rising Stars Akash Deep, Vijaykumar Vyshak, Umran Malik, and Yash Dayal

Akash Deep, Vijaykumar Vyshak, Umran Malik, and Yash Dayal have also made significant contributions to their respective teams. Akash Deep’s swing bowling and ability to generate movement off the pitch have made him a formidable bowler. Vijaykumar Vyshak’s control and accuracy have been instrumental in building pressure on the opposition. Umran Malik, known for his express pace, has consistently clocked speeds above 150 km/h, making him one of the fastest bowlers in the league. Yash Dayal’s left-arm pace and variations have added a new dimension to his team’s bowling attack.
